> Commit 2f845882ecd2 ("integrity: Add errno field in audit message")
> introduced an audit log function that can take an error code. It is
> wrapped by integrity_audit_msg() that implicitly sets the error code
> argument to zero. The problem is that there are uses of integrity_audit_msg()
> such as ima_collect_measurement() that hide the failure cause for
> the message.
>
> This series aims to convert integrity_audit_msg() call sites to
> integrity_audit_message(), and then expose error codes based on the
> following criteria:
>
> 1. The log depends on a result from earlier callee, and/or
> 2. The caller function itself returns with that result
>
> ima_release_policy() is the only caller I thought made sense to keep as
> is. The message doesn't correlate with a return code, nor does it
> depend on a result from an earlier callee in the function.
